.product-name,.product-price{font-size:1.5rem}.product-name{width:60%}.product-info-block~form>div:before{color:#7fffd4;font-size:1rem;margin-bottom:.5rem;color:#00000080!important;font-weight:400!important}.product-brands p{text-transform:capitalize}.product-price{text-align:right;width:40%}.product-price>span{white-space:nowrap;width:auto;display:inline-block}.product-price .was{text-decoration:line-through;color:gray;padding-left:.625rem;font-size:1.25rem}.product-info-block{border-bottom:.0625rem solid rgba(170,173,147,.4);padding:.9375rem 0}.product-info-block .cart-quantity{border:.0625rem solid #aaad93;margin-right:.5rem}.product-info-block .cart-quantity button,.product-info-block .cart-quantity input{height:100%;background-color:#aaad931a}.product-info-block .cart-quantity button:hover{background:#f5f1ee}.product-info-block .cart-quantity .quantity-input{border-radius:0;border-left:.0625rem solid #aaad93;border-right:.0625rem solid #aaad93}.product-info-content p{margin-bottom:.5rem}.product-info-content a{text-decoration:underline}.product-info-title{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;font-size:1rem;margin-bottom:.5rem;color:#00000080}.size-guide,.size-guide:hover,.size-guide:focus{text-decoration:underline;outline:none}.add-to-favorites__link{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;color:#000c;font-size:1.125rem}.add-to-favorites__icon{overflow:hidden;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;height:1.875rem;width:1.5625rem;margin:0 .3125rem;padding:.3125rem}.add-to-favorites__icon img{max-width:4.6875rem;height:4.625rem}.learn-more,.info-center{position:relative;padding-left:1.875rem;margin-top:1.25rem}.learn-more:before,.info-center:before{position:absolute;top:-.125rem;left:0}.info-center:before{content:url(np_email.svg)}.learn-more:before{content:url(np_return.svg)}.learn-more__link{font-size:.75rem;margin-top:.5rem;display:inline-block;text-decoration:none!important;color:#00000080}.learn-more__link:after{content:url(arrow.svg);display:inline-block;vertical-align:middle;margin-left:.3125rem}.swatch{margin-bottom:.625rem}.swatch label{height:2rem;width:2rem;background-color:#aaad931a;border:.0625rem solid transparent;line-height:2rem;text-align:center;cursor:pointer;position:relative}.swatch label:hover{background:#f5f1ee}.swatch label .crossed-out{position:absolute;top:50%;left:0;-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%)}.swatch input{display:none}.swatch input:checked+label{outline:none;border:.0625rem solid #aaad93;background-color:#aaad931a}.swatch .color-label{width:2.3125rem;height:2.3125rem;border-radius:1.25rem}.swatch .swatch-element{display:inline-block}.collapsible .product-info-title{cursor:pointer;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;margin-bottom:0}.collapsible .product-info-title:after{content:url(arrow-top.svg);-webkit-transform:rotate(-180deg);-ms-transform:rotate(-180deg);transform:rotate(-180deg);display:inline-block;margin-left:.625rem}.collapsible .product-info-content{padding-top:.9375rem;display:none}.collapsible.open .product-info-title:after{-webkit-transform:none;-ms-transform:none;transform:none}.collapsible.open .product-info-content{display:block}#sizeGuideModal .modal-dialog{max-width:46.875rem}@media (max-width: 61.99875rem){#product-description{max-width:37.5rem;margin:0 auto 3.125rem}#product-description .product-name,#product-description .product-price{text-align:left;width:100%;margin-bottom:.625rem}#product-description .product-price{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}#product-description .product-price .product-price{display:block;width:auto;margin:0}#productRecommendation .slick-list{padding:0 15% 0 0!important}#mobileImageSlider .product-image__big img{margin:0 auto}#mobileImageSlider .slick-dots{bottom:.625rem}#mobileImageSlider .slick-dots li{border-radius:50%;width:.625rem;height:.625rem;border:.0625rem solid #fff}#mobileImageSlider .slick-dots li.slick-active{background-color:#fff}#mobileImageSlider .slick-dots button{width:.5rem;height:.5rem;padding:.25rem}#mobileImageSlider .slick-dots button:before{content:none}.leftSidebar{display:none}}@media (min-width: 62rem){.product{display:-webkit-box;display:-ms-flexbox;display:flex;margin:0 -.75rem 9.375rem}.product>div{padding:0 .75rem}.product-image{-webkit-box-flex:0;-ms-flex:0 0 55%;flex:0 0 55%;max-width:55%;margin:-.5rem}.product-image__big img{padding:.5rem}.leftSidebar{-webkit-box-flex:0;-ms-flex:0 0 10%;flex:0 0 10%;max-width:10%}.rightSidebar{-webkit-box-flex:0;-ms-flex:0 0 35%;flex:0 0 35%;max-width:35%}.thumbnail-gallery{margin-top:-.375rem}.thumbnail-gallery>a{display:inline-block;margin:.375rem 0}.thumbnail.activeThumbnail{border:.0625rem solid rgba(0,0,0,.2)}}.product-info-block .preorder-description{width:100%;position:absolute;top:100%}.product-info-block .quantity{position:relative;padding-bottom:.625rem;margin-bottom:2.1875rem}.affirm-as-low-as{display:block;position:absolute;right:0;width:200px;margin-top:61px}@media (max-width: 900px){.affirm-as-low-as{display:unset;position:unset;right:unset;width:unset;margin-top:unset}}
/*# sourceMappingURL=/s/files/1/0739/2881/t/53/assets/style-product.css.map */
